About this item:
  • Large Coverage Area – Effectively removes moisture in spaces up to 4,500 sq. ft., ideal for basements, large rooms, and whole-home use.
  • 3x More Water Capacity – Extended water tank holds more, so you empty it less often—perfect for longer, uninterrupted operation.
  • Built-In Pump with Drain Hose – Automatically drains water upward into a sink or out a window for hands-free convenience.
  • Smart Wi-Fi Control – Use the MSmartHome app or voice commands with Alexa and Google Assistant to monitor and control settings remotely.
  • Compact Lift-and-Twist Design – Operate in extended or nested form for flexible use and easy storage when not in use.

I've also had one of these since 2023 with a hose draining into the sink. It works great to keep the humidity down. I had to put a fan next to it to circulate the air more through the space, but once I did that it really helped. And since it doesn't need the bucket after connecting the hose, I use the bucket for mopping and washing the car 😂

I bought one of these from Costco for $160 in May 2022 and its been running (on eco mode) 24/7 in my basement like a champ, hose mode right into my sump basin. I take it out once a year to hit it with a compressed air nozzle to clean out the dust as ive been finishing my basement. No complaints. I don't connect it to my wifi.
